CHARLIE'S TRIPS - A new-looking science-fiction novel in the tale-for-children style, about a young soldier in a special condition after a space-time travel


July 9, 2011 (FPRC) -- LONDON, ENGLAND ? Jack Felson?s Charlie?s Trips is a fiction story that uses some of the famous past myths and today?s values (family, marriage, religion, television, celebrity...), and reverses or enriches them.
Charlie Bradshaw is an American kid soldier from the deep Middle West who gets caught by a tornado ? the connection with The Wizard of Oz stops here, the rest is total science-fiction with some more involved. He's disintegrated inside the tornado and... reintegrated 21 years later, on the West Coast. He's found unconscious on a beach. But his brutal appearance, which is very quickly publicised ? nobody knows his name and where he came from ?, makes him hailed as somebody very special (like the Christ) by always more and more people.
Things go even worse for him as he emerges from coma with a terrible prediction (another disaster, an upcoming earthquake) without being aware he's live on TV camera; later on he realizes that he lost his memory... and gained an ability to see in the future.
Written in a simple, straight, very cinematic way, Charlie?s Trips is an insolent tale of science-fiction that plays with several literary and cinematic myths, as it introduces us to a new kind of hero: an ?amnesic psychic? ? able to see in the future when he lost his past ? and a total outcast in a stranger world, unable to do anything but wonder about himself and his situation and condition, and totally dependent on the others? actions. As it also asks us this question: is it possible to live in ?reverse mode??

About the author
Jack Felson is a French bilingual author ? novelist, screenwriter and playwright ?, also a filmmaker. He?s already published two collections of short stories: After AIDS (2002) in France, and Four (2007) in the United States. Charlie?s Trips, written in English, is his first published novel. He?s currently based in London, England.
